TE Digital
TE Digital is the leading independent, Summit Level Salesforce Partner in the UK, with an outstanding reputation for delivery success across the Salesforce, Databricks & Anthropic ecosystems. Building on the momentum of the last few years, we are now investing in the significant expansion of our Sales, Marketing and Alliances function - scaling the team to match growing demand for TE’s services. This is a rare opportunity for a Client Solutions Director to join a proven, high-performing commercial team at a pivotal point in its growth. The ThirdEye team is of the highest calibre, and the company is obsessed with making ThirdEye the best place to work in the ecosystem, with regular team days, social events, training opportunities and employee benefits available to everyone.
What you will do:
- Identify and pursue strategic customers by prospecting, networking, and utilising your industry expertise & relationships.
- Partner with our Marketing Manager, Alliances Manager & external technology vendors to identify joint opportunities & account-based marketing plans.
- Develop and implement account based strategies to meet sales targets, focusing on building long-term customer engagements.
- Deploy relationship mapping techniques to identify and align with key customer stakeholders that position ThirdEye as a trusted partner.
- Align with our delivery organisation to design and present integrated solutions - bringing together CRM, data and AI (Salesforce, Databricks and Anthropic) - that connect a customer's data foundation to measurable business and AI outcomes
- Engage with your network to stay aligned to latest innovation & trends across CRM, data and AI, Industry dynamics and the competitive landscape to impact commercial strategy

What you have done:
- Proven successful experience in business development, sales, or account management role within either the Salesforce, Databricks or Anthropic ecosystem.
- Built and nurtured long term relationships with your customers where you have been positioned as their trusted advisor.
- Demonstrated your ability to grasp the key concepts of identifying, scoping and positioning technical implementation solutions that align to strategic business objectives.
- Orchestrated internal teams to align to support with the functional and technical needs of your customer
- Developed a reputation for being a proactive, self-motivated team player, who takes accountability for KPI attainment

Who you are:
- Previous experience working in a solutions focused role, where you have owned the lead-to-close cycle
- Naturally a networker, confident building new relationships with customers & partners from diverse backgrounds
- A sales driven individual, with an aptitude for providing value and building trust with your customers through the demonstration of industry & product expertise
- Comfortable with outwardly projecting the brilliance of the ThirdEye team, in person, over the phone or by giving presentations
